The ASC W80 is our third-generation aluminum-wood system for windows and doors, constructed from thermally broken aluminum profiles featuring 24 mm wide polyamide strips.
ASC WOOD System Summary
-
Core Concept: ASC WOOD is an aluminum profile system with a thermal break, combined with real wood profiles for interior cladding, primarily designed for residential buildings.
-
Aesthetics and Application: The wood interior is treated to match various modern and classic interior designs, offering an exclusive product feel.
-
Thermal Performance: The system is available in two core models (using 24mm and 32mm polyamide bars) with identical external/internal looks, and allows for flexible, further thermal insulation upgrades using special materials to meet specific isolation level requirements.
-
Materials: It uses high-quality EN AW6060 aluminum, protected by anodizing or powder coating (QUALIANOD/QUALICOAT), with thermal breaks from leading producers (Technoform/Ensinger). The interior is solid hardwood (oak, ash, beech) treated for low moisture content.
-
Design & Hardware: The system supports the production of all types of residential windows and doors (single/multiple sashes, tilt-and-slide), and is designed for simple workshop production, using standard PVC window hardware.

A perfect blend of cost-effectiveness and technical performance. Thermal systems for windows and doors are widely used in both residential construction and commercial and public buildings (schools, hospitals, nursing homes, etc.).
Our offering includes three basic models with a thermal break width of 24, 32, and 54mm, all with a completely identical appearance.
From both the exterior and the interior, these systems offer the flexibility to choose in accordance with the planned budget and desired technical performance.
Technical performance of the chosen system can be significantly improved with specific details and materials.
The installation of all types and configurations of double and triple-pane glass is possible.
XPS profiles fill the space of the thermal break between the polyamide strips, thereby significantly improving the thermal insulation of the window.
LDPE profiles are used to fill the space between the glass and the aluminum profile of the frame (sash), which significantly reduces air permeability under wind load, while simultaneously achieving a better level of thermal insulation.

Aluminum profile system without thermal break with a basic profile width of 48 mm.
Suitable for all types of interior partitions, doors, shopfronts, and portals.
To meet the diverse requirements of investors and system manufacturers, Aluminating offers two series of profiles without a thermal break on the market.
Aluminating 48 is a more robust system with a profile width of 48mm and a statically more stable geometry, intended mainly for external shopfronts and large-area portals with wider grids and greater heights.

A system of aluminum profiles without a thermal break, featuring a basic profile width of 40 mm. Suitable for the production of doors, shopfronts, and portals where minimal visual participation of aluminum profiles is required.
To meet the diverse requirements of investors and system manufacturers, Aluminating offers two series of profiles without a thermal break on the market.
Aluminating 40 is a lighter and more elegant series adapted predominantly for interior partitions and doors, as well as for external portals with a lower static height.
Both systems are designed with a wide range of profiles and shapes to satisfy all current market needs, designers, and processors who wish to utilize the aesthetic and functional advantages of aluminum over other materials.
